[libc++] Use addressof in vector.
authorMark de Wever <koraq@xs4all.nl>
Sun, 10 Oct 2021 13:40:50 +0000 (15:40 +0200)
committerMark de Wever <koraq@xs4all.nl>
Thu, 21 Oct 2021 15:28:17 +0000 (17:28 +0200)
This addresses the usage of `operator&` in `<vector>`.

I now added tests for the current offending cases. I wonder whether it
would be better to add one addressof test per directory and test all
possible violations. Also to guard against possible future errors?

(Note there are still more headers with the same issue.)
